Practicing small conversations every day

One of the easiest ways to improve spoken English is through daily conversation. Speaking with friends, colleagues, or classmates helps people get comfortable using the language in normal situations. The conversation does not need to be complex. Even simple topics like daily routines, news, or work tasks can help build speaking confidence. The more frequently a person speaks, the easier it becomes to form sentences naturally without overthinking every word.

Listening to natural English speech

Listening plays a big role in developing fluency. Movies, interviews, podcasts, and short videos expose learners to real pronunciation, tone, and rhythm. When people hear how native speakers structure sentences, they start recognizing patterns that improve their own speaking style. Listening regularly also helps learners understand how words connect during normal conversations rather than in slow classroom speech.

Thinking in English during daily activities

Many learners translate sentences from their native language before speaking English, which slows down conversations. A helpful habit is to start thinking directly in English during everyday tasks. While commuting, cooking, or planning the day, people can silently describe what they are doing using simple English sentences. This mental practice trains the brain to process ideas directly in English instead of translating them.

Reading aloud for better pronunciation

Reading English text aloud helps improve pronunciation and sentence flow. When learners read articles, short stories, or even news headlines out loud, they practice how words sound together in sentences. This method also improves clarity and confidence while speaking. Over time, learners become more comfortable expressing longer thoughts without pausing too frequently.

Expanding vocabulary through real use

Vocabulary grows faster when words are used in real conversations rather than memorized from lists. Learners can focus on learning a few new words each day and try using them in discussions. This habit helps the words stay in memory because they are connected with real situations. Recording and reviewing speech

Another helpful practice is recording short voice clips while speaking about simple topics. Listening to these recordings helps learners notice pronunciation errors, repeated words, or unclear sentences. This self-review process allows gradual improvement because learners become aware of areas that need practice. Even short recordings made regularly can show noticeable progress over time.
